Algerian President Abdelmadjid Tebboune has declared a national day of mourning following devastating wildfires that swept through several regions in the country’s center and east on Wednesday. The fires, which erupted in multiple locations across northern Algeria, resulted in numerous civilian deaths. The declaration of national mourning, announced on Thursday, August 27th, underscores the severity of the tragedy. Details regarding the extent of the damage and the specific number of casualties are still emerging. The fires have impacted multiple localities, causing widespread concern and prompting a national response.
